Description
The Italian island of Sardinia is a wonderful corner of the Mediterranean, and this self-guided cycling trip is the perfect way to tour it. As your luggage is transferred between your overnight stops, you'll be free to enjoy your route unencumbered. Armed with detailed route notes and maps, you'll cycle down undulating country lanes and coastal roads in the island's south west, through olive groves, oak valleys and to secluded coves and rugged cliffs. As well as the great cycling, the route is designed to give you time to get off your bikes to explore a little – this is an area with plenty of culture and one that prides itself on its unique regional cuisine. Your itinerary includes stops at wineries, olive oil mills, organic farms and traditional bakeries and you'll also enjoy delicious home cooked evening meals at charming guesthouses and 'agriturismo' farm hotels.
